** Volunteer
Summary:
** Copper Mountain’s Junior Ski Patrol program is for high school age students looking to expand their medical experience in a fun, fast paced outdoor environment. While volunteering with Copper Mountain Ski Patrol you will be expected to develop proficiency in mountain orientation, ski patrol procedures, an understanding of the Colorado Skier Safety Act while being trained to assist in providing medical assistance to and evacuation of injured guests, evaluating risk, executing assigned projects and daily duty station responsibilities, equipment maintenance and other assigned duties.
* Must be a proficient skier or rider
* Hold current Outdoor Emergency Care (OEC) certification and current CPR certification
* Must be high school student, between 15
-18 years old and willing to commit a minimum of 2 seasons to the program
* Must be able be available 14 days/season, including three training weekends (First three weekends of December)
*
* Essential Duties and Responsibilities:
*** Medical: assessment, stabilization/treatment and evacuation of injured guests
* Reporting/Documentation:
Incident documentation and procedure familiarity with computers. Accident reporting additional forms associated with incidents on the mountain
* Managing Risk: i.e. trail checks, trail openings/closings, early season preparation, maintenance, obstacle marking, signage, sweeps, and special race preparation.
* Mountain Orientation:
Learn trail names, lifts and landmarks patrol uses to navigate and communicate the breadth of the mountain efficiently
* Search and rescue:
Participate in drills and assist in execution of rescue if necessary
* Lift evacuation:
Assist distributing lift tickets or guest direction if necessary
* Skier education:
Enforcement of Skier Safety Act, i.e., boundary management, safe skiing, speeder control. Being visible to the public for skier information.
* Training/development:
All staff will participate in continued training and development to demonstrate proficiency in all areas of patrolling. This constant and ongoing process includes medical preparation (medical lectures), terrain management, lift evacuation, mountain/company policies, inter-agency relations and contacts, etc. Ski improvement through all terrain with varying snow conditions.
* Duty station assignments: PHQ, Timberline and Lower Patrol Room
* Integration with other Copper Mountain departments for smoother functioning within the company. Orientation in areas of mountain safety awareness.
